The Bliss Wrap from our Journeys travel collection is made from 150gm fabric - our lightest weight of pure merino - and is a versatile layer for all seasons. It can be worn three ways, so there's a look for every occasion. The Bliss has cosy inset pockets, a sash and front buttons.
The Journeys range of lightweight, versatile merino layers can be worn across seasons and continents, solo in the heat or layered up in cooler weather. They're ideal for travel because they regulate temperature, breathe to prevent overheating, resist odour naturally, pack light, are machine washable and dry in a flash.

New favourite clothing item. After seeing the way it drapes on the fairly tall models, I decided to take a chance on this, being 1.58m tall myself, because it was too darn adorable. I'm so glad I did. I've found most IB clothing is wide in the shoulders, and this wrap is no exception - that suits me well, as I have man shoulders from yoga, but smaller-framed women may want to size down. I didn't find any problems with the snug arms. They fit me perfectly, though the ribbed part of the arm is a little long, so I roll it back and create a little cuff when I wear it. I'm fairly small to begin with, about 52 kg, and it's very slimming on my somehow-both-athletic-and-hourglass frame. It drapes nicely and covers my rear even when I wrap it my preferred way, with the straps tied around the back of my neck. Very versatile, flattering, and practical - pockets!! - highly recommended. I just wish it came in more colours! January 9, 2013

perfect wrap, but arms are a little snug I love this wrap and how versatile it is. It's very comfortable and easy to wrap it different ways. Sometimes I even use it as a sort of robe when lounging around the house--it's super cozy and luxurious. I bought the XL and I'm glad I did (I have an Icebreaker jacket in size XL, siren tank in L and Roma dress in L). The fit is perfect but the arms are a little snug, especially the ribbed part (not uncomfortably tight, just snug). The snugness in the arms also makes it nearly impossible for me to layer anything long-sleeved under this. I don't think the ribbed part of the sleeves is very flattering on me and it makes the wrap look a little too "sporty" for my taste. If you have long slender arms it will probably look great on you, but I think it looks a little silly on my plump short arms. Nonetheless, I love how the fabric drapes and it's otherwise very flattering and comfortable. I'd definitely recommend it. January 6, 2013
